国防科学技术大学

可实施的COSMIC方法研究

作者:
周泽龙

关键词:
COSMIC方法度量元度量实施识别矩阵

摘要:
COSMIC方法是通用软件度量国际协会(Common Software Measurement International Consortium)依据软件工程等的基本原理开发的一种软件规模度量方法,主要应用于商业软件、实时软件和中间件。由于COSMIC度量手册中并没有对度量实施进行详细的说明,导致度量人员在度量实施中存在着主观和不一致的情况,阻碍了功能规模度量方法的推广与应用。本文主要是对可实施的COSMIC方法进行研究,以减少度量中的主观和不一致的情况。本文重点是研究一种可实施的度量流程,介绍了COSCMIC方法的标准度量流程,总结了COSMIC方法在实施中存在的四个主要困难,并进行了原因分析。针对存在的困难和原因分析,提出一种可实施的COSMIC度量方法,并运用两个具体案例验证了本文方法的有效性。本文的主要工作如下:1.分析了COSMIC方法在实践运用中存在的困难。总结了在实践中运用COSMIC方法的四种主要困难,并且对存在的困难进行了原因分析。为可实施的COSMIC方法的提出提供了依据。2.提出了一种可实施的COSMIC方法,针对度量手册存在的规则不完善、实际操作的指导性不强、理解偏差以及主观臆断等四个困难,总结和补充了从需求文档中提取FUR、提取度量元素、识别数据组、甄别数据移动、识别层、识别功能过程以及排除重复度量等11类共计68个具体规则。本文提出了完全遵循需求的句法分析方法提取度量元素,降低了对需求理解的不一致;提出了避开感兴趣对象直接从数据属性出发的提取数据组的矩阵识别方法,更好的降低了主观性;提出了一个顺序迭代度量流程,降低了对实施流程不同导致的不一致。3、对可实施的COSMIC方法进行了验证。选择一个面向终端用户的课程注册系统和面向硬件的中间件系统网关系统,有针对性的通过实例,验证了方法的可行性和准确性,较好的提升了一致性。

在线下载

相关文章:
在线客服:
对外合作:
联系方式:400-6379-560
投诉建议:feedback@hanspub.org
客服号

人工客服,优惠资讯,稿件咨询
公众号

科技前沿与学术知识分享